Output 0820840af4fbf07b3239d7cb19995aafe0b2fb2a77eeb52b34ef7a7a92f69c81:0

value
103700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a902117da9d69577315f15a5028c74f2fb1fe9cb OP_EQUAL
address
3H6ebfyNY6NqGqxYU5c1TCHzybzVcos8kv
transaction
0820840af4fbf07b3239d7cb19995aafe0b2fb2a77eeb52b34ef7a7a92f69c81
spent
true